Meaning and Origin

Sylva, a name of Latin origin, embodies a deep connection to the natural world. Its meaning, "of the forest" or "woods," conjures images of verdant landscapes and the tranquility of nature. As a variant of Sylvana, Sylva shares the essence of its root, evoking a spirit of adventure and a love for the outdoors. The name's connection to nature adds a sense of grounding and serenity, offering a reminder of life's simple pleasures.

Pronunciation and Spelling

Sylva is pronounced with a simple and clear "sil-vuh," making it easily pronounceable. The name's spelling is straightforward, minimizing the chances of mispronunciation. Nickname Choices

While not as common as some names, Sylva offers a few charming nickname options. "Sylvie" is a popular and playful diminutive, capturing the name's elegance and grace. "Syl" provides a more casual and informal nickname, perfect for close friends and family.

Variation and Similar Names

Sylva has variations, including "Sylvia" and "Sylvana," each with its own distinct character. Similar-sounding names include "Sylvan," "Silva," "Sylvi," and "Sylvina," sharing phonetic elements and a connection to nature.
